i’d confirm whether referred steps below clear cached credentials , certificates , flush dns.
1. log out of skype business.
2. delete sign-in info , exit skype business.
3. open run bar , type in %appdata%. make sure you're in appdata directory , navigate \local\microsoft\office\16.0\lync\ skype business
4. delete sip_profilename folder. if not see folder, check \local\microsoft\communicator directory.
5. delete files in tracing folder. not delete folder itself.
6. clear dns cache: in command prompt run ipconfig /flushdns command.
if not, please try them again , let me know how work.
meanwhile, checked domain information , noticed it’s federated domain. thus, recommend turn admin verify have trusted root certification authority (ca) installed. if issue persists, i’d collect following information further troubleshooting:
